Web2 de jun. de 2024 · Pacemakers are generally safe; however, there may be few side effects present, which include: Infection at the pacemaker’s site. Swelling, bleeding or bruising at the pacemaker’s site. A collapsed lung. Damage to blood vessels or nerves near the pacemakers. Allergic reaction to dye or anesthesia used during the surgery. WebThe pacemaker is implanted under the skin of the chest, and there is no need for open- heart surgery. The procedure is done under local anesthesia, although medications may be given to make the patient sleepy and comfortable during the procedure. Web1 de jan. de 2004 · At 5 years after first pacemaker-implantation, 57.0% of patients implanted in the first decade were still alive, as opposed to 67.9% of those implanted in the second and 74.5% of those implanted in the third decade. Similarly, survival at 10-years post implant was 36.8%, 47.0% and 52.4% respectively.
